- The Pride Program is now part of Foundations Minnesota, a new entity designed to strengthen mental and behavioral health services, expand programming, and ensure long-term sustainability.
- This transition allows us to better meet the needs of our communities while also preserving the Pride Program’s LGBTQ+ specialty outpatient track.
- What does this mean for our patients and partners.
- Our Minneapolis outpatient location will continue offering the Pride Program’s LGBTQ+ specialty track.

Skills, Responsibilities & Benefits
Key skills and qualifications: Alcohol And Drug Counseling, Treatment Planning, Diagnostic Assessments, Progress Reviews, Continuing Care Planning, Individual Counseling, Group Counseling, Recovery Education. Candidates with experience in these areas may be especially well-suited for this Substance Abuse role.
Core responsibilities: The intern will provide ongoing assessments, treatment planning, diagnostic assessments, progress reviews, and continuing care planning within the multidisciplinary treatment team.
